After it failed, I heard that NUON systems actually sold half decent, but the manufacturers kept the profits from the hardware, and VM labs (the company behind NUON) kept the profits from game sales. So when people bought them as fancy DVD players but didn't buy games for them, Samsung and Toshiba ended up getting all the money. It would also explain why the manufacturers advertised them as DVD players with extra bells and whistles, but didn't advertise that they played games.

What if I told you that Merlin Racing was later split into 4 different games for the PS1 (presumably due to DVD vs CD storage capacities): XS Airboat Racing, ATV Racers, Miracle Space Race, and Rascal Racers, which combined offer the content of Merlin Racing, presumably with not as good graphics and possibly sound. Merlin Racing was developed by the same developers, Miracle Designs, as Atari Karts, which it's considered to be a spiritual successor of.

I have seen a few of these at thrift stores over the past few years. You can sometimes find them thrown in with the regular DVD players since no one at Goodwill or wherever knows that it's also a game system. Just look for the nuon logo on the front. Nuon systems aren't well know but they also aren't all that rare either.
